AVO Heritage Short Robusto ND Cello Cigar - 1 Single - End of Line
Date Added: Thursday 26 March, 2026
Nice looking cigar, short with a heavy ring gauge, unfussy band, nice looking mocha coloured wrapper. Cut with a single V, much looser draw than expected, vast amounts of thick, cool white smoke, unfortunately it had a seriously wonky burn line and needed multiple corrections on one side; although, this improved in the last third. Ash was flaky but held on surprisingly well dropping every half inch or so. Medium body and medium low strength. Lots of spicy leather upfront alongside dry cacao powder, shifts to spicy black pepper, finish is coffee and cedar with a touch of roasted nut. Decent flavours, outstanding smoke output but hard work due to the substantial burn issues, although it never needed a relight. I'd have another at £15 but wouldn't spend any more.
